2026 Furnace Replacement Cost Estimates for Trimont

  • 80% AFUE gas furnace: $2,700 – $4,200
  • 96% AFUE high-efficiency gas furnace: $3,900 – $5,800
  • Two-stage or variable-speed furnace: $4,500 – $7,000

Trimont has natural gas service. Rural farmsteads in the Martin County township area may be on LP propane. LP homes should strongly consider the highest efficiency tier available—the greater fuel cost per BTU makes the efficiency upgrade pay back much faster than on natural gas.

What Drives Furnace Cost in Martin County

Southwestern Minnesota cold. Martin County accumulates significant heating degree days each season—this region averages well over 8,000 HDD annually. Equipment efficiency directly translates to meaningful dollar savings over the heating season.

Limited contractor competition. Trimont's small size means you're likely getting quotes from contractors based in Fairmont or Sherburn. With limited options, equipment markup is often included without transparency. Factory-direct purchasing separates the equipment cost from the labor cost, giving you full visibility.

Home vintage. Martin County has older housing stock. Pre-1980 homes may have original ductwork that should be inspected and sealed during a furnace replacement. Duct sealing adds $300–$600 but can improve efficiency by 10–15%.

Venting for high-efficiency. Upgrading from 80% to 96% AFUE means switching from chimney venting to PVC direct-vent. Budget $200–$500 for new PVC runs if your current furnace uses a metal flue.

Frequently Asked Questions

How much does furnace replacement cost in Trimont, MN?

Most Trimont homeowners pay $2,700–$5,800 for a complete furnace replacement. 96% AFUE high-efficiency units run $3,900–$5,800 installed including labor.

Does Furnace Direct ship to Trimont, MN?

Yes. We deliver factory-direct to Trimont and throughout Martin County. Your local HVAC contractor handles installation.

What furnace size do I need in Trimont?

Most Trimont homes need 60,000–100,000 BTU. Your installer should run a Manual J load calculation for the precise size.

Is Martin County a natural gas area?

Trimont has natural gas service. Rural areas and farmsteads may be on LP propane. We supply LP-compatible Goodman furnaces for propane homes.

How long does furnace installation take in Trimont?

Most installations complete in 4–6 hours. Venting changes or ductwork work adds 2–4 hours. Same-day completion is standard.
